OpenClaw Docker镜像:快速部署与高效容器化应用指南


在当今云原生与微服务架构盛行的时代,Docker容器技术已成为开发者和运维团队不可或缺的工具。而OpenClaw,作为一个备受关注的开源项目或工具,其官方或社区维护的Docker镜像,为使用者提供了极致的便捷性。本文将深入探讨OpenClaw Docker镜像的核心价值、获取方法以及最佳实践,助您快速上手并优化部署流程。

首先,理解OpenClaw Docker镜像的意义至关重要。Docker镜像是一个轻量级、可执行的独立软件包,它包含了运行OpenClaw所需的一切:代码、运行时环境、系统工具、库和设置。通过使用预构建的OpenClaw镜像,用户能够彻底摆脱环境配置的繁琐,实现“一次构建,处处运行”。无论是开发、测试还是生产部署,都能确保环境的一致性,极大提升协作效率和软件可靠性。

那么,如何获取并使用OpenClaw的Docker镜像呢?通常,您可以在Docker Hub等公共镜像仓库中,通过搜索“openclaw”来查找官方或社区版本。使用命令`docker pull [镜像名]`即可轻松拉取。在运行镜像时,通常需要根据OpenClaw的具体功能进行配置,例如通过`-v`参数挂载数据卷以持久化数据,或使用`-p`参数映射必要的网络端口。仔细阅读镜像的配套文档,了解其暴露的端口、环境变量和默认配置,是成功运行的关键第一步。

为了最大化发挥OpenClaw Docker镜像的效能,遵循一些最佳实践必不可少。建议始终使用带有明确版本标签的镜像,而非默认的latest标签,以确保部署的确定性。在安全方面,定期更新镜像至最新安全版本,并扫描镜像中的漏洞。对于生产环境,结合Docker Compose或Kubernetes进行编排管理,可以轻松实现服务的高可用、弹性伸缩和滚动更新。此外,基于官方镜像构建符合自身业务需求的定制化镜像,也是一种常见的进阶用法。

总之,OpenClaw Docker镜像将复杂软件的部署简化为一条简单的命令。它不仅是技术现代化的体现,更是提升开发运维效率的利器。通过熟练掌握其拉取、配置和优化方法,您可以将更多精力聚焦于业务逻辑创新,而非环境维护。立即尝试部署您的第一个OpenClaw容器,体验容器化技术带来的敏捷与高效吧。